About this resource
This service offers a variety of support for older adults and adults with disabilities, such as assessments, case management, and the administration of programs like SNAP (food stamps), the Oregon Supplemental Income Program (OSIP), other Medicaid initiatives, Medicare Savings Programs, along with information and referrals to coordinated services.
Intake Procedure: You can either walk in or call for additional details. Some programs may necessitate an in-person or phone interview appointment.
Fees: There are no fees associated with these services.
Who can use this
- Individuals aged 60 and above, as well as adults with disabilities who are 18 and older.
